The following illustration shows the rear connectors on the hot-swap-drive backplane, as viewed from the rear of the server. SCSI cable connector SCSI power cable connector I2C cable connector The following illustration shows how to install a hot-swap hard disk drive in the server. When you install hot-swap hard disk drives, install them in the following order: bay 7, bay 6, and bay 5. Filler panel Drive tray assembly Drive tray handle (in open position) Attention: v When you handle static-sensitive devices, take precautions to avoid damage from static electricity. For details on handling these devices, see "Handling static-sensitive devices" on page 114. v To maintain proper system cooling, do not operate the server for more than 10 minutes without either a drive or a filler panel installed in each bay. To install a hot-swap hard disk drive in bay 5, 6, or 7, do the following: 1. Review "System reliability considerations" on page 44. 2. Read the information in "Preinstallation steps (all bays)" on page 53. Note: You do not have to turn off the server to install hot-swap hard disk drives in these bays. Installing options 57
